الملخص EN

Displayers tend to become three-dimensional.

The most advantage of holographic 3D displays is the possibility to observe 3D images without using glasses.

The quality of created images by this method has surprised everyone.

In this paper, the experimental steps of making a transmission hologram have been mentioned.

In what follows, current advances of this science-art will be discussed.

The aim of this paper is to study the recent improvements in creating three-dimensional images and videos by means of holographic techniques.

In the last section we discuss the potentials of holography to be applied in future.
